company logo

Customer Onboarding Manager - Government in Mc Lean, VA

Save

compensation:

$150K - $200K*

specialty:

Business Intelligence & Analytics, Technology Management

experience:

5 - 7 years

Job Description

Role Description

The role will be instrumental in establishing a relationship with each assigned distribution partner thereby converting them into active promoters of OneWeb services.

The onboarding manager shall collect the required information to set up the service and configure the various tools required for provisioning, monitoring, billing and communications systems to support them. This data-gathering occurs in distinct phases of the customer lifecycle: 1) Feasibility & business requirements analysis, 2) Detailed technical assessment, 3) Provisioning, 4) Training, and 5) User acceptance testing.

The candidate is expected to lead from the front minimising customer escalations through proactive customer management and advocating customer needs/issues cross-functionally in regular business reviews thereby converting distribution partners into advocates.

Key Responsibilities & Accountabilities Include (but

See More

Valid through: 2020-4-9

About OneWeb

Total Jobs:
40
Total Experts:
2
Average Pay:
$135,217
Total value of jobs:
$6,220,000
% Masters:
50%
Learn More About OneWeb
* Ladders Estimates